That’s what Bono sings at the 46664 concert (at 4:25). Elsewhere he says, “I think one of the things that has set our band apart is the fact that we chose interesting enemies. We didn’t choose the obvious enemies – The Man, the establishment. We didn’t buy into that. Our credo was: no them, there’s only us. Think about it.”
It’s easy to hear a feelgood slogan. But what about Bin Laden? The 1%?
Voldemort!
Aren’t they THEM?
It takes an adjustment to see the world from a meme perspective – where all human beings are US, and THEM are the many, competing, often-adversarial memes that influence us. What’s important to separate is us (human beings) from them (our ideas and beliefs). Not easy, but important.
